			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class='snap_preview'><br /><p>if you are searching for good EPG Data for AT/DE/CH with categorys and stuff, you might just have found the answer.<br />
You might think: &#8220;Why doesn&#8217;t this bloke use nxtvepg..?&#8221;,  Well, i took a look, but since i found a good grabber and i read that nxtvepg doesn&#8217;t provide more than a few days of guide data, i will stick with the grabber.<br />
first i tried tvm2xml from: <a href="http://mythtv.linux-dude.de/">http://mythtv.linux-dude.de/</a><br />
it works quite good, is quite fast, but i just can&#8217;t get good epg data for some of the channels.<br />
after a while of searching i read about epgdata.com, they are providing good epgdata ready to download in xml format for a little anual fee.<br />
you can grab and use the data with tv_grab_eu_epgdata from the xmltv package which you should download manually from the xmltv project site since the version in the portage tree is quite old.<br />
you can get 16 days of epg data from epgdata.com.<br />
it may be possible to get some more, but the grabber seems to be broken since it exits with an error if you specifiy more than 16 days.<br />

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class='snap_preview'><br /><p>well, since i did not try the new mainboard with our TV, i also did not know wether the HDMI Output works and wether it is capable of sending 1366&#215;768 to the TV.<br />
so it was time to try.<br />
The TV is some Samsung 32&#8243; LCD, the native resolution is 1366&#215;768.<br />
this is what i did to make it work:<br />
follow these instructions to make Direct Rendering work: <a href="http://gentoomythtv.wordpress.com/2008/09/07/final-parts-arrived/">click</a></p>
<p>add no additional lines to your xorg.conf<br />
switch on your TV, disconnect VGA, connect HDMI output to your TV.<br />
start X.<br />
wait, voila!<br />
it just works out of the box, seems that the samsung TV sends proper EDID Data.<br />
there are no black lines, dead pixels or whatever, it just works perfectly.<br />
i did not configure anything regarding the hdmi output.<br />
the next thing on my list is a splashscreen to show while booting. (so the init scripts do not scare my girlfriend that much <img src='http://s.wordpress.com/wp-includes/images/smilies/icon_smile.gif' alt=':)' class='wp-smiley' />  )</p>
<p>after some testing i am now sure that the graphics part is setup properly, the processor utilization while watching tv or videos does not exceed 2 %, the picture looks good and sharp, there is no flicker or whatsoever, the scaling works (most of the TV Channels are 4:3 in this country&#8230;).<br />
it seems that everything just worked &#8220;automagically&#8221;.<br />
I saw many reports of people having severe trouble with the Abit I-N73HD regarding sound, graphics and network, as well as with the antec fusion regarding IR/VFD/Volume Knob.<br />
So if you need a mainboard with HDMI output or a decent HTPC Case or both, don&#8217;t hesitate, it works.<br />

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class='snap_preview'><br /><p>different subject same story, there are no exact instructions on how to make the volume knob work with lirc, so i will do a quick howto on that too.</p>
<p>for me there was nothing special about getting the knob to work.<br />
i just installed lirc as described in the post below, after that i played around with irrecord and that&#8217;s it.<br />
(fyi: irrecord creates a [remote] section for the lirc config)<br />
if you want to do this yourself use this command:<br />
<code>#irrecord -d=/dev/lirc</code><br />
follow the instructions.<br />
<span id="more-102"></span><br />
if you are lazy you could use my config:<br />
<code>begin remote<br />
  name  ClickWheel<br />
  bits           16<br />
  eps            30<br />
  aeps          100<br />
  one             0     0<br />
  zero            0     0<br />
  post_data_bits  16<br />
  post_data      0x0<br />
  gap          131995<br />
  toggle_bit_mask 0x30000<br />
      begin codes<br />
          VolUp                    0x0001<br />
          VolDown                  0x0100<br />
      end codes<br />
end remote<br />
</code></p>
<p>simple as that.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class='snap_preview'><br /><p>since there are no exact instructions on how to get the vfd to work with LCDd/lirc i will write a quick HowTo.</p>
<p>if you know the thread on codeka.com about how to get it to work it might be helpful, but the instructions there are not all you need to know.</p>
<p>first you need lirc and LCDd.<br />
use these vars in your make.conf:<br />
<code>LCD_DEVICES="imon"<br />
LIRC_DEVICES="imon imon_knob imon_lcd imon_pad"</code></p>
<p>add this line to your /etc/portage/package.use file<br />
<code>app-misc/lcdproc lirc usb</code></p>
<p>now just emerge lirc and lcdproc.</p>
<p><span id="more-96"></span></p>
<p>let&#8217;s see if there is an usb device we can use:<br />
<code>#lsusb<br />
Bus 002 Device 002: ID 15c2:ffdc SoundGraph Inc. iMON PAD Remote Controller<br />
Bus 002 Device 001: ID 1d6b:0001<br />
Bus 001 Device 001: ID 1d6b:0002<br />
</code><br />
if you got the ffdc model, than this instructions are for you, i read that some other models requiere patching, i don&#8217;t know what to do exactly because i got the ffdc model shipped with the newer fusion v2 cases.</p>
<p>now let&#8217;s see if the modules are already loaded:<br />
<code>#lsmod | grep lirc<br />
lirc_imon              15372  0<br />
lirc_dev               12904  1 lirc_imon<br />
usbcore               148632  4 lirc_imon,ohci_hcd,ehci_hcd<br />
</code></p>
<p>remove the module:<br />
<code>rmmod lirc_imon</code></p>
<p>and modprobe it withe the <strong>important argument</strong> is_lcd=0<br />
where 0 is the older vfd display (16&#215;2 characters, negative blue backlight, appears to be off when no text is displayed)<br />
1 is the newer lcd display.<br />
if you do not supply is_lcd=0 it will simply not work.<br />
<code>#modprobe lirc_imon is_lcd=0</code></p>
<p>start LCDd and see if it succesfully created the device:<br />
<code>#/etc/init.d/LCDd start<br />
#ls /dev/lcd*<br />
/dev/lcd0<br />
#ls /dev/lirc*<br />
/dev/lirc /dev/lirc0 /dev/lircd<br />
</code></p>
<p>you are ready to go! (if there is no lircd device you may have to start lircd as well)<br />
test the LCD:<br />
<code>#echo "TESTME" &gt; /dev/lcd0</code></p>
<p>if the string appears on the display you got it right!</p>
<p>now what to do to make this permanent?</p>
<p>first add this to /etc/modprode.d/lirc<br />
<code>options lirc_imon is_lcd=0</code><br />
add the lirc_imon module to /etc/modules.autoload.d/kernel-2.6</p>
<p>that&#8217;s it.</p>
<p>just for you to understand (i didn&#8217;t know this at first)<br />
LCDd is the Server, it &#8220;wakes&#8221; the Display and takes connections from clients, these clients are telling LCDd what to do with the Display.<br />
lcdproc is one of these clients for example, it will loop several info screens about the computer state.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class='snap_preview'><br /><p>Since the last part of the HTPC Solution arrived yesterday, i am installing the mythtv frontend on it right now.</p>
<p>ok, so whats the last part(s)?<br />
after some google searches i decided to go for this:</p>
<p>-ABIT I-N73HD mainboard, geforce 7100 onboard graphics, nforce630i chipset, hdmi output.<br />
i read that several people had problems getting this board to work under linux and i have to admit, there is no problem, after configuring the kernel it worked right out of the box without any hassle.</p>
<p>-e2200 c2d processor, not that powerful, but cheap and cool.</p>
<p>-arctic cooling freezer 7 lp, for the case i bought it had to be a small cooler, this one is not very small in fact, but its height is optimal for the case.</p>
<p>-2.5&#8243; notebook drive, not that fast, but it is cooler, more quiet and of course smaller than a 3.5&#8243; one.</p>
<p>-2gb of RAM, actually i got 4gb, but after ordering 4&#215;1gb i noticed that there are only 2 ram slots on the mainboard, so now i got 2gb spare&#8230;</p>
<p>-Antec Fusion V2, looks nice, perfect cooling solution (got two fans on the side which are sucking the hot air directly from the cpu cooler), vfd display, builtin IR receiver, volume knob.<br />
<div id="attachment_91" class="wp-caption aligncenter" style="width: 210px"><a href="http://gentoomythtv.files.wordpress.com/2008/09/fusionv2.jpg"><img src="http://gentoomythtv.files.wordpress.com/2008/09/fusionv2.jpg?w=200&#038;h=200" alt="fusion v2" title="fusion v2" width="200" height="200" class="size-thumbnail wp-image-91" /></a><p class="wp-caption-text">fusion v2</p></div><br />
<span id="more-90"></span><br />
so what do you have to pay attention to while installing?<br />
if you want to use lm_sensors to control the fans you obviously have to turn off the abit EQ fancontrol thingie in the bios.<br />
for the sensors you need these modules:<br />
w83627ehf<br />
coretemp</p>
<p>to get the SATA controller to work you need this kernel options:<br />
<code><br />
CONFIG_SCSI=y<br />
CONFIG_BLK_DEV_SD=y</code></p>
<p>if you want to use the nvidia proprietary drivers, you need this:<br />
<code>Loadable module support ---<br />
  [*] Enable loadable module support<br />
Processor and Features ---<br />
  [*] MTRR (Memory Type Range Register) support<br />
Device Drivers ---<br />
Character devices ---<br />
[*] /dev/agpgart (AGP Support)<br />
Device Drivers ---<br />
Graphics Support ---<br />
[ ]  nVidia Framebuffer Support<br />
[ ]  nVidia Riva support</code></p>
<p>now just:<br />
<code># emerge nvidia-drivers</code></p>
<p><code># modprobe nvidia</code></p>
<p>Xorg config:<br />
(substitute the videoram amount to what you specified in the bios)<br />
<code>Section "Device"<br />
  Identifier "nVidia Inc. GeForce7"<br />
  Driver     "nvidia"<br />
  VideoRam   65536<br />
EndSection<br />
Section "Module"<br />
  (...)<br />
  # Load  "dri"<br />
  Load  "glx"<br />
  (...)<br />
EndSection</code></p>
<p><code># eselect opengl set nvidia</code></p>
<p>hopefully:<br />
<code>$ glxinfo | grep direct<br />
direct rendering: Yes</code></p>
<p>add the xvmc and the nvidia use flag to your make.conf and you should be ready to fly.<br />
<em>Referring to a comment from chguedel you do not need xvmc for this configuration.</em></p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class='snap_preview'><br /><p>as mentioned in an earlier post the c3 becomes very hot.<br />
i bought the enzotech cnb-r1 mentioned before (<a href="http://gentoomythtv.wordpress.com/2008/08/25/temperature-problems/">click</a>)<br />
running with a fan it is a little bit better, but while testing with stress (a test tool, app-benchmarks/stress) the c3 reached about 85 °C which is the maximum temperature referring to the data-sheet.<br />
so i stuck another 40mm fan between the northbridge and the cpu cooler to blow the hot air from the cpu cooler to the hard disk where the &#8220;exhaust&#8221; fans are located.<br />
this did not &#8220;solve&#8221; the problem but now i can close the case and the CPU temperature stays below 80°C.<br />
if the system is in idle (also while watching videos or tv), the temperature immediately drops to 40°C and stays there.<br />
It is strange indeed, the Temperature of the CPU only goes up significantly if the load is higher than 3.00, below that there is no problem, so for the every-day-use of the frontend it will be good enough.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class='snap_preview'><br /><p>after fiddling around with mplayer and the openchrome overlay i did not get mplayer with xvmc to work.<br />
i don&#8217;t think openchrome causes the problems, everytime i tried to play a video with -vo xvmc mplayer told me that this video_out device is not compatible with the codec.<br />
I don&#8217;t know what this means or why mplayer says that and it did not matter what codec the video was encoded with, so i gave it up.<br />
somewhere i read about xine so i emerged it with the xvmc USE Flag, quickly went over the setup of xine.<br />
(just execute `xine` while in x session, right click -&gt; settings)<br />
configured mythfrontend to use xine -f for mythvideo (-f = start in fullscreen)<br />
that&#8217;s it, no magic happens here, just the xorg-server from openchrome overlay, the driver from openchrome overlay and xine.<br />
it works out of the box, has lirc support, nice osd and i can play back videos with ~60% CPU Utilization.<br />
what do you want more, compared with the fiddling with mplayer this took me 20 minutes (inlcuding the compiling of xine-lib, xine and oxine) and simply worked.<br />
I am sure that there is a simple way to get xvmc to work with mplayer, but i just did not figure it out.</p>
